Output 14ddf93142bfce7767cfc805c64f7159f85b2033f1dedc9cc9b10519187c376a:4

value
52747809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92c68de5ed28ced7f16ef55b7e5a0434e000946f OP_EQUAL
address
MMHEkENT2aCzSS1Mc6fCaFLBSRhVwwSG5r
transaction
14ddf93142bfce7767cfc805c64f7159f85b2033f1dedc9cc9b10519187c376a
spent
true